Recognizing Common Fridge Troubles
Refrigerators are vital in keeping your food fresh, yet they can run into a series of typical problems that interrupt their efficiency. One regular problem is insufficient air conditioning. If you notice food ruining quicker than normal, inspect the thermostat settings or think about if the door seals are damaged. An additional common issue is extreme sound, which might indicate a malfunctioning compressor or a falling short follower. You may additionally experience water pooling inside or below the refrigerator; this frequently arises from a clogged up defrost drainpipe or a damaged water line. Furthermore, if your refrigerator's light isn't functioning, maybe an easy bulb problem or a trouble with the door button. Lastly, ice buildup in the fridge freezer can impede airflow and cooling effectiveness. Recognizing these concerns early can conserve you money and time in repairs, guaranteeing your refrigerator runs efficiently and effectively.

Tidy Condenser Coils Frequently
Cleansing your condenser coils consistently can substantially enhance your appliance's efficiency. Dust and dirt develop on these coils over time, triggering your appliance to work more challenging and take in even more power. To keep them tidy, disconnect your device and carefully remove any type of safety covers. Utilize a vacuum cleaner with a brush add-on or a soft brush to delicately remove particles. If required, a combination of cozy water and light cleaning agent can assist get rid of stubborn grime. Make certain to allow everything completely dry entirely before reassembling and plugging the device back in. Goal to cleanse your coils at the very least two times a year, or regularly if you have animals or reside in a messy atmosphere. This straightforward task can expand the life-span of your appliance significantly.
Check Door Seals
Three easy steps can help you ensure your appliance's door seals remain in excellent problem. First, evaluate the seals frequently for any kind of cracks, splits, or indications of wear. These problems can bring about air leakages, influencing performance. Second, clean the seals making use of warm, soapy water to get rid of any kind of debris or crud. A clean seal ensures a limited fit and far better performance. Execute a basic test by shutting the door on a piece of paper. If you can quickly pull it out without resistance, the seal could need replacing. By following these actions, you'll maintain your appliance's efficiency and longevity, saving you money on energy bills and repair services in the lengthy run.
Display Temperature Settings
Routinely checking your home appliance's temperature setups is necessary for finest efficiency and performance. Whether you're handling a fridge, freezer, or oven, maintaining an eye on these settings can stop lots of issues. For fridges, go for temperature levels in between 35 ° F and 38 ° F; for freezers, linger 0 ° F. If the temperatures are too expensive or low, your device might function harder, losing energy and reducing its life-span. Utilize a thermostat to check these settings frequently, specifically after major modifications, like moving your appliance or changing the thermostat. If you observe changes, readjust the setups accordingly and consult the user handbook for guidance. By staying proactive regarding temperature level surveillance, you'll guarantee your devices run smoothly and last longer.
Fixing Air Conditioning Concerns
When your fridge isn't cooling correctly, it can lead to spoiled food and lost money, so dealing with the concern immediately is critical. Beginning by examining the temperature level setups to validate they're at the advised levels, normally around 37 ° F for the refrigerator and 0 ° F for the freezer. If the setups are proper, inspect the door seals for any type of voids or damages; a malfunctioning seal can permit warm air to go into.
Inspect the condenser coils, typically situated at the back or base of the device. Clean them with a vacuum cleaner or brush to maximize efficiency. If issues continue, it could be time to call an expert.

Addressing Noisy Refrigerator Appears
While it might appear startling, a noisy fridge commonly signals small concerns instead than major malfunctions. Usual wrongdoers consist of the compressor, followers, and water lines.
Following, look for loose items inside. Sometimes, containers or racks can rattle, creating unwanted sound. Tighten up or reposition them to get rid of the sounds.
If you observe a clicking noise, it may be the defrost timer. This is normally harmless yet can show it needs assessment.
Lastly, confirm your refrigerator is level. An unbalanced device can produce vibrations and noise. Utilize a level to examine, and adjust the feet if needed. Addressing these concerns promptly can assist preserve your fridge's performance and prolong its life expectancy.
